The Importance of Range Hood CFM
Range hood CFM is a crucial metric for any kitchen. It determines how effectively a range hood can clear away smoke, steam, odors, and airborne grease that accumulate while cooking. A hood with insufficient CFM can lead to a buildup of these unwanted elements, compromising air quality and creating an uncomfortable cooking environment.
Moreover, a properly functioning range hood can enhance a kitchen’s overall functionality. A higher CFM allows for quicker ventilation, which is particularly beneficial in kitchens that frequently prepare heavy or aromatic dishes. Understanding what your cooking habits demand in terms of air movement can guide you toward the right CFM rating.

Choosing the Right Type of Range Hood
There are various types of range hoods available, each with distinct features and CFM capacities. Understanding these options can help you choose the best fit for your kitchen’s needs:
- Wall-Mounted Hoods: These are often the most powerful options and can handle high CFM ratings, making them suitable for professional-grade cooking ranges.
- Under-Cabinet Hoods: These fit under cabinetry and can range widely in CFM. They are popular for home kitchens due to their space-saving design.
- Island Hoods: Designed for range islands, they often offer higher CFM capacities to accommodate cooking in open layouts.
- Downdraft Hoods: Typically integrated into the cooktop, these are less powerful, making them suitable for lighter cooking styles.
Each type has its advantages depending on your cooking habits, kitchen layout, and aesthetic preferences. Assessing these factors will help you hone in on the appropriate CFM for your specific needs.
Common Myths Surrounding Range Hood CFM
There are several misconceptions about range hood CFM that can mislead homeowners in their selection process. One common myth is that a higher CFM is always better. While it’s true that a powerful hood can effectively manage smoke and odors, excessively high CFMs may lead to issues such as noise or excessive air draw from your home, potentially causing discomfort.
Another myth is that all cooking styles require the same CFM. This is not the case; cooking methods that produce more grease and smoke, such as frying, will demand higher CFM ratings compared to methods like boiling or steaming. Tailoring your hood choice to your cooking style is crucial for achieving an effective balance in ventilation.
Maintenance Considerations for Range Hood CFM
Once you’ve selected a range hood with the appropriate CFM, it’s crucial to maintain it to ensure its longevity and efficiency. Regular cleaning of the filters is essential, as dirty filters can significantly reduce airflow and effectiveness. Depending on your cooking frequency, filters should be cleaned or replaced every few months.
Additionally, check the ductwork connected to your range hood. Blockages or leaks can impede airflow, making the CFM rating less effective. Ensuring that your system is free from obstructions will help maintain optimal performance.
Understanding how your range hood CFM operates in conjunction with regular maintenance can ensure that your kitchen remains a safe and pleasant environment for cooking.
